## Deployment

The Lumacache image service has a known slow leak in its thumbnail cache layer: evicted entries keep a reference alive through the decoder pool, so resident memory creeps up roughly 40 MB per hour under steady load. Until the refactor in the Harkness branch lands, we mitigate by capping pool size and scheduling a rolling restart every 12 hours. Deploy with the supervisor, never bare, or the restart hook won't fire. The deployment relies on the configuration values listed below.

settings of bagug-tahof:
holath:
  pin: 7837
  metrics_host: metrics.holath.tolvaqsys.internal
  tenant: quenath
  seal: seal_6001b3af

Snapshot diffs flaky for third-party widgets in Quillboard 4.2. Plugin-rendered components produce nondeterministic snapshots when the host theme loads async. Workaround: call finalizeTheme() before snapshot capture. Fix lands in the next plugin SDK release. If your plugin still fails after updating, file against component "snap-harness" and attach the token printed below.

build token for kagaf-hahof: htk14_9d3d4d26d7d8de

Ticket PRUNE-412 — StaleSweep bot misconfigured in staging

For the weekly sync: StaleSweep skipped its branch-cleanup run on the Harrowell staging cluster because its env file pointed at the retired API host. Fixed the host entry, but the run still fails because the bot's credential never made it into the file. The missing entry belongs on the next line.

env line for fafof-fahag: LEDGER_TOKEN5=f8790